Office of International Education Program Center

Overview

The OIE Program Center is available to faculty, staff and student organizations holding meetings or events of an international nature. Located on the fourth floor of Holthusen Hall, the center features a kitchen and can accommodate a wide range of events from small and medium size meetings to larger receptions. The space can be used as a whole or split into two separate rooms to host smaller meetings.

Technology

The OIE Program Center is a smart room including a screen, projector and computer connection capabilities. You may either provide your own laptop or reserve an OIE laptop. Wireless internet access is readily available for computers registered with Marquette's IT Services. Lighting is adjustable in the room. The technology is only available in Program Center North.


Program Center Kitchen

All groups, organizations and individuals using the OIE Program Center kitchen must read and agree to the Rules for Use:

  • Pre-event: label food and store in proper location
  • Bring any necessary supplies to cook, bake or eat with, as OIE has a very limited supply of utensils and dishes
  • End event at scheduled time (including clean-up)
  • Leave kitchen and function areas clean (OIE provides dish detergent and other cleaning supplies): 
    - washing dishes and tables used
    - cleaning counters and stovetop
    - mopping kitchen floor
    - vacuum (if needed)
  • Do not leave any food in ovens or on top of stove
  • Bring containers and/or plastic wrap for any leftovers or take-away
  • Do not leave anything behind – anything left in the fridge or in the OIE Program Center becomes the property of OIE and may be discarded
